The aerial mycelium, substrate mycelium growth and
pigmentation showed distinct variation based on the
culture media in which the isolates were grown. Among
the four culture media used, most of the isolates growth
was excellent in starch casein agar and this may be due to
sufficient amount of nutrient included in this media. Valli et
al. also observed leathery, white powdery, creamy, pinpoint
